Unlike Ma Yun, Ding Lei is a low-key Jin Yong fan.

24 years ago, Ma Yun invited Jin Yong to the West Lake to "discuss the sword in Huashan", and the only few entrepreneurs who could sit opposite Jin Yong were Ding Lei. At that time, Ding Lei told Jin Yong that he liked Duan Yu and Wang Yuyan the most.

In business, Ding Lei is closer to Jin Yong than Ma Yun.

Previously, NetEase owned many martial arts IP games such as "Under Heaven" and "Against the Cold". In 2024, the centenary of Jin Yong's birth, NetEase invested a team of 600 people, 6 years and 1 billion yuan to unveil Jin Yong's IP game "Shooting the Condor", and the public beta time was set on the day after the commemoration of Jin Yong's centennial.

Ding Lei said that the current market is in need of very high-quality martial arts-themed games.

However, with Jin Yong's most prestigious IP, the high-profile announcement of "Shooting the Condor", as of April 21, 25 days after its launch, the iOS side has a turnover of 27.45 million yuan (Diandian data), with a score of 2.5. This number is less than one-tenth of the same period of "Fellow Senior Brother" "Against the Cold", and it is dozens of times different from "Genshin Impact" that wants to be benchmarked.

Looking back on the history of Jin Yong's IP game adaptation, cases of failure abound. From online games to stand-alone games, from large factories to independent studios, most of them cannot escape the fate of "hitting the streets".

Why did Jin Yong's IP, which has its own traffic and hundreds of millions of book fans, become a "curse" that game manufacturers can't get out of?

NetEase bent the bow, "Shooting the Condor" was not completed

Ding Lei once ridiculed Jin Yong like this: "Jin Daxia, you have delayed the time of our generation of young people." ”

Now, "Condor Shooting" has "delayed" NetEase.

NetEase has high expectations for "Condor Shooting", and smashed in 1 billion real money, which began to warm up two years before the game was launched. In exchange, there are overwhelming negative reviews and worries from investment banks.

According to Diandian data, the first day of the launch of "Condor Shooting" on iOS was $220,000, less than 1/6 of the same period of "Against the Cold", and the daily turnover has not risen significantly since then, but has fallen all the way.

JPMorgan Chase pointed out in a research report that due to the weaker than expected initial performance, the first-month turnover forecast of "Condor Shooting" was lowered from 400 million ~ 500 million yuan to 100 million ~ 150 million yuan, and the turnover forecast for the first 12 months was lowered from 3 billion ~ 4 billion yuan to 1 billion ~ 2 billion yuan.

At present, the iOS score of "Condor Shooting" is only 2.5 points, which is significantly lower than "Against the Cold" (3.5) and "The Moon Knife at the End of the World" (4.5). Some players commented with disappointment, "It's a waste of Jin Yong's such a good IP".

Since the launch of the server, the official Weibo of "Condor Shooting" has been full of voices from players who are dissatisfied with the picture quality and optimization. After many updates and optimizations, there are still a large number of players who report problems such as blurry picture quality, stuck and overheating on the mobile phone, and some people even complain that this is "2014 picture quality".

In terms of gameplay, "Condor Shooting", which tries to find a middle way between the social-light "Genshin Impact" and the social-heavy "Against the Cold", has been commented by many players as "I don't understand how to play". The young art style and young character modeling are also the hardest hit areas for players to complain.

The reason why NetEase invested heavily in "Shooting the Condor" is largely because of the IP power behind the word "Jin Yong".

NetEase's "Condor Shooting" covers Jin Yong's most famous works "Condor Trilogy", including "The Legend of the Condor Heroes", "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" and "The Legend of the Sky and the Dragon".

At the beginning of Jin Yong's establishment of "Ming Pao", the sales volume in the first year was only 1,000 copies, and it was once on the verge of bankruptcy. However, after the serialization of "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" and "Heaven and Dragon Slayer" was completed, the annual sales of "Ming Pao" have reached 50,000 copies. In the words of writer Ni Kuang, "Ming Pao did not go out of business, it all relied on Jin Yong's novels."

Ni Kuang also commented that "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" "established Jin Yong's status as a giant of martial arts novels, and people no longer doubt whether Jin Yong can write a great work."

According to incomplete statistics from Snow Leopard Finance Agency, up to now, the Condor Trilogy has been remade more than 30 times. The 83 version of "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" and "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" have broken the ratings many times, according to the "Hong Kong TV" magazine, the ratings of "The Legend of the Condor Heroes" once exceeded 90% in Hong Kong.

And the combination of well-known IP and games can indeed collide with surprising sparks.

The martial arts-themed game "Against the Cold" developed by NetEase is adapted from Wen Ruian's three novels, "The Four Famous Catches", "Who Are the Heroes" and "The Wonder of China". According to Sensor Tower data, in 2023, the mobile game "Against the Cold" will bring NetEase more than 10 billion yuan in turnover. Tencent's "Tianya Moon Knife" is adapted from Gu Long's martial arts novels, and it is still the top player in the martial arts game track.

NetEase's mobile game "Harry Potter: Magic Awakening" launched in 2021 has moved Hogwarts to the screen and attracted many players because it largely restores the magic knowledge class, prom, fireworks show and other activities in the original book. In the first week of its launch, it beat "Glory of Kings" and ranked first in the revenue list, with a turnover of more than 1 billion yuan in the first month.

NetEase, which has tasted the sweetness of IP adaptation, this time, why did it make a mistake on Jin Yong's IP, which is regarded as a myth by the film and television industry?

The "Jin Yong's Curse" in the gaming industry

Jin Yong's IP gamification began in 1993 with "Smiling Proud Jianghu" launched by Zhiguan Technology, and has a history of more than 30 years.

With the name of Jin Yong's IP first game, "Smiling Proud Jianghu" sold more than 100,000 sales. Zhiguan Technology, which was little-known at that time, took the opportunity to quickly launch a number of Jin Yong IP games. Among them, "The Legend of Jin Yong's Heroes", which is a mixture of 14 Jin Yong novels, has become a masterpiece, and in the 90s of the last century, it was once as famous as "The Legend of Sword and Fairy". To this day, many game forums still have players discussing this ancient game.

After entering the millennium, games have moved from the stand-alone era to the era of online games, and a new martial arts trend has been set off.

Yuquan International's "Smiling Proud Jianghu Online Version" became popular with the first domestic 3D martial arts game, driving the "XX Jianghu" series to follow the trend. At its peak, Sohu Changyou's "Deer and Ding Ji OL" had more than 300,000 people online at the same time, and "Xiaoao Jianghu OL" launched by Perfect World after acquiring a subsidiary of Yuquan International achieved 400,000 online users, which was the highest record for martial arts online games at that time.

However, at this stage, the aura of Jin Yong's IP has gradually failed in the game industry, and martial arts-style online games have finally been short-lived.

On the one hand, the more mature South Korean, European and American online games entered China at that time, and "Running Kart" and "World of Warcraft" squeezed out the position of "rivers and lakes". On the other hand, leather martial arts games and "title parties" have emerged in an endless stream for a long time, and games with Jin Yong's IP have become a means for many manufacturers to make quick money.

They quickly attracted a large number of users with the aura of Jin Yong, but players were quickly dissuaded by the shoddy game content, and even PTSD (post-traumatic stress disorder) appeared, resulting in the gradual loneliness of the entire martial arts game track.

The once popular "Smiling Proud Jianghu Online Version" and "Lu Ding Ji OL" both ended with the closure of the service. The only survivor of this stage is Sohu's "Tianlong Babu OL", which was launched in 2007 and is still the company's most important cash cow, accounting for more than 70% of its revenue. However, the absolute value of 3.3 billion yuan in revenue is far less than popular games such as "Honor of Kings" (10.7 billion yuan) and "PUBG Mobile (Peace Elite)" (8.2 billion yuan).

In the era of mobile games in the past 10 years, Jin Yong's IP is no longer a sweet spot in the eyes of game manufacturers. Perfect World is still trying to gamify Jin Yong's IP in its hands, and launched mobile game versions after the end games of "Heaven and Dragon Slayer OL" and "Legend of the Condor Heroes OL" were suspended, but the response was mediocre and unpopular.

The recent open world fever has brought Jin Yong's IP into the player's field of vision again.

NetEase's "Shooting the Condor" has wanted to benchmark "Genshin Impact" from the beginning, and the production team once mentioned "Genshin Impact" 23 times in a documentary. Tencent's "To Jin Yong", which is still under development, is also positioned as an open-world martial arts game.

The natural audience of Jin Yong's IP-adapted games is users who have watched Jin Yong's martial arts novels since childhood, but this group is mostly males between the ages of 36~45 (Editor's note: The data sample comes from users who buy Jin Yong's books on the Jingdong platform, disclosed by "Jingdong Big Data"), which is neither the current mainstream gamers nor the main consumer of game products. At the beginning of the planning, the production team of "Condor Shooting" tried their best to get rid of this confinement, adopting a younger approach in modeling, and benchmarking the gameplay against "Genshin Impact".

On the other hand, "Against the Cold", which is better in terms of commercial performance, was written nearly 30 years later than "The Legend of the Condor Heroes", and the gamers are younger. According to the data, the proportion of players aged 24~30 in "Against the Cold" is more than 60%.

Throughout the history of Jin Yong's IP adaptation games, in the past 30 years, games that have fallen under Jin Daxia's "sword" abound. When the knights are getting old, how much aura can Jin Yong's IP be given to this condiment?

Success is also IP, defeat is also IP

For adapted games, IP is not only a guarantee for cold starts, but also a shackle for content and word of mouth.

As a national-level IP, "Condor Shooting" unsurprisingly enjoyed dividends before it was launched. According to NetEase, there are more than 14.5 million pre-registered players for "Condor Shooting". But it is precisely because the story of the Condor Trilogy is so deeply rooted in the hearts of the people that it is very difficult to adapt the game.

Players are already familiar with the story text, and are familiar with the endings and plot trends of the main characters, so the game naturally has a lot less room for exploration. In contrast, games that do not have the restrictions of the original IP tend to be more free in terms of content creation. Original stories such as "The Legend of Sword and Fairy" and "Xuanyuan Sword" make it easier to give players a new game experience. "Genshin Impact" creates freshness by releasing a new character and a new plot almost every month.

And the creation of new plots and content is often not bought by fans of the original book because of "subverting the classics", and is even considered to be "magically changing" the plot and being labeled as "skin".

On the other hand, games adapted from big IPs have a large number of initial players, but they also have to withstand more rigorous scrutiny from fans of the original work. IP will also become an amplifier of word-of-mouth. Good game content + big IP will gain double the attention and volume. But when the quality of the game is not high, the IP aura will instead put the shortcomings in the spotlight and expose them to discerning players.

For example, "Harry Potter: Magic Awakening", which was well received for its high degree of restoration in the early days, started high and low in the later game content, and many of the original content in the original book was not updated for a year after it was launched, and the PVP (player vs. player) balance was poor, which eventually led to a decline in revenue.

At present, "Harry Potter: Magic Awakens", which has been online for more than two years, ranks outside the top 100 on the iOS best-selling list and has become "others". Games such as Perfect World's "Zhu Xian" and "Wulin Gaiden" also replicate this curve of opening high and going low.

The pit that NetEase's "Condor Shooting" stepped on is precisely because it attaches too much importance to IP and is obsessed with amplifying the influence of IP itself, but ignores the content.

According to a report released by the Game Working Committee, more than 60% of core mobile game players pay the most attention to image quality, gameplay and painting style when choosing products, and only 20% of players attach the most importance to IP. And the influence of the IP of martial arts works itself is gradually declining.

According to Gamma Games, from January to September 2023, game IPs adapted from novels only contributed 1.83% of the mobile game IP market revenue.

The ability to attract money from the top works in the IP adaptation of literary works is also very limited. From January to September 2023, a total of 12 products adapted from cross-domain (including animation, literature, sports, etc.) IP have been listed on the TOP 100 list of mobile games. Among them, animation IP adaptation products accounted for 59.16%, while literary IP only accounted for 21.43%.
